Bhagdari is a village in Akkalkuwa in Nandurbar district of Maharashtra State, India. It is located 36 kilometres (22 mi) from sub district headquarter and 86 kilometres (53 mi) from district headquarter. The village is administrated by Sarpanch an elected representative of the village as per Panchayati raj (India).[1] As of 2009, The village has a total number of 1259 houses and a population of 7087 of which 3583 are males while 3504 are females.[1]
